# 小型网页项目实现:文本转HTML的网页开发


背景介绍

在现代网页开发中,文本处理功能日益重要。通过将用户输入的文本转换为HTML格式,不仅能够实现数据交互,还能为网页提供丰富的信息展示。本项目旨在实现一个小型网页,用户可以输入任意文本,系统自动将其转换为HTML格式,从而在网页中显示内容。这为Web开发中的数据处理提供了实际应用场景,同时加深了对文件操作和数据结构的理解。

思路分析

本项目的核心逻辑分为三个主要部分:文本输入处理、HTML模板生成和文件输出保存。
1. 文本输入处理:需读取用户输入的文本,并进行基础的数据处理。
2. HTML模板生成:将文本转换为HTML字符串,确保标签结构正确。
3. 文件输出保存:将生成的HTML内容保存到文件或实时显示在浏览器中。

关键知识点包括:
– 文件读写操作(例如使用open()函数)
– 数据结构的应用(如字符串处理、列表操作)
– HTML结构的构建与验证

代码实现

def text_to_html(text):
    html_content = f"<html>\n<head>\n<title>{text}</title>\n</head>\n<body>\n<h1>{text}</h1>\n<p>This is a sample.</p>\n</body>\n</html>"
    return html_content

# 示例输入
input_text = "Hello World"
html_output = text_to_html(input_text)
print(html_output)

总结

本项目通过实现文本转HTML的功能,不仅验证了文件操作的基本原理,也展示了数据结构在网页开发中的应用。关键步骤包括:
1. 使用open()函数读取输入文件或内存中的文本
2. 构建HTML结构并验证标签格式
3. 保存输出内容到指定位置或显示在浏览器中

实际应用中,应考虑输入来源的稳定性、文本的可读性以及输出格式的可执行性。通过本项目,学习了文件处理和数据结构的核心概念,为后续的Web开发积累了实践经验。